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2005.10.30;
Скачать: CL | DM;

Вниз

Подскажите плиз как корректно реализовать   Найти похожие ветки 

 
Alex_T ©   (2005-10-04 20:30) [0]

попытка вставить значение a"a    в текстовое поле и соответствующая ошибка в связи с тем что в данном случае строкой считается а
надо а"а

Query.SQL.Add("INSERT INTO Table_Name (Field_Name) VALUES ("a"a");");


 
Desdechado ©   (2005-10-04 20:43) [1]

использовать параметры


 
wicked ©   (2005-10-05 00:57) [2]

обычно в документашке к БД указывается, как в строках указывать кавычки/апострофы.... на вскидку, правильными вариантами могуть быть:
1) предыдущий постинг - 100% правильно
2) ... VALUES ("a"a") -> ... VALUES ("a""a")
3) ... VALUES ("a"a") -> ... VALUES ("a\"a")

ЗЫ уходи с парадокса... хотя бы на sqlite...


 
Германн ©   (2005-10-05 01:11) [3]

2 wicked ©   (05.10.05 00:57) [2]
Ну, имхо, не стоит так хулить Парадокс, если нет описания задачи. Он всё-таки для Борланда - родное дитя, хоть и "заброшенное" в последнее время, по словам АП.


 
Alex_T ©   (2005-10-06 19:35) [4]

подкорректирую вопрос
вместо аа может подставляться строка переменной длинны и в строке может использоваться весь набор символов
Query.SQL.Add("INSERT INTO Table_Name (Field_Name) VALUES ("aа");");
так что смена кавычек на апострофы не повлияет


 
Anatoly Podgoretsky ©   (2005-10-06 19:48) [5]

Германн ©   (05.10.05 01:11) [3]
Он детя не родное, а приемное и потом изгнаное за недостойное поведение, дураки нашлись в лице Корела, но оии все скупали, что продавалось.


 
Anatoly Podgoretsky ©   (2005-10-06 19:50) [6]

wicked ©   (05.10.05 00:57) [2]
Ты что думаешь дело в Парадоксе чтоли?


 
Alex_T ©   (2005-10-06 20:48) [7]

Может подкинет кто ответ на поставленый вопрос?
Или скажет что это не возможно сделать........


 
Desdechado ©   (2005-10-06 21:54) [8]

еще раз
использовать параметры
qry.sql.text:="insert into tabl values(:p1,:p2)";
qry.params[0].asstring:="ааа"ббб";


 
wicked ©   (2005-10-06 22:59) [9]

> Alex_T ©   (06.10.05 19:35) [4] и [7]
см. [8]....
также, если хочется позаморачиваться со строками, смотрим на ф-цию AnsiQuotedStr - она делает как раз п. 2 постинга wicked [2].... если нужен п. 3 - пишем сами - 10 минут работы....

> Anatoly Podgoretsky ©   (06.10.05 19:50) [6]
нет, конечно не думаю.... просто увидел в теме "парадокс" и высказал своё мнение.... осадочек, так сказать.....


 
Германн ©   (2005-10-07 01:38) [10]

2
> Anatoly Podgoretsky ©   (06.10.05 19:48) [5]
>
> Германн ©   (05.10.05 01:11) [3]
> Он детя не родное, а приемное

Не знал! :(

А я думал, что такой вариант может быть только у меня :(
Моя единственная продаваемая программа (для РС), как раз из разряда "не родное, но любимое".

P.S. Анатолий. Можно ли как-то обратиться к Вам  по E-Mail?



Страницы: 1 вся ветка

Текущий архив: 2005.10.30;
Скачать: CL | DM;

Наверх




Память: 0.46 MB
Время: 0.038 c
1-1128429401
tw
2005-10-04 16:36
2005.10.30
Уменьшение размера приложения


3-1127092937
DrAndrey
2005-09-19 05:22
2005.10.30
Перехват ошибки в хранимой процедуре при добавлении строки


14-1128586993
BURN
2005-10-06 12:23
2005.10.30
Пятнашки


14-1128848907
pazitron_brain
2005-10-09 13:08
2005.10.30
Телефон, паяльник и волны...


2-1128697503
ArtemESC
2005-10-07 19:05
2005.10.30
Цифра Extended





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ский